The Lazz isn’t interested in playing it safe—and “Observer” makes that clear within seconds. This isn’t just a metal single; it’s a fully immersive piece of a much larger world, one that’s built as much on philosophy and visual imagination as it is on riffs and hooks. From the outset, “Observer” feels विशाल. The guitars drive with purpose—tight, deliberate, and heavy without becoming numb—while the melodic leads stretch the track into something more atmospheric. There’s a real sense of scale here. It doesn’t just sound big, it feels elevated, like it’s reaching for something beyond the usual boundaries of modern metal.

What separates this from the endless stream of heavy releases is intent. The track isn’t just aggressive for the sake of it—it’s focused. The concept of a seeker shedding illusion and fear could easily come off as abstract, but here it’s grounded through structure and dynamics. The verses pull you inward, almost introspective, before the chorus opens everything up into something soaring and anthemic. It’s that contrast—internal vs. expansive—that gives the song its weight. there’s a strong sense of control. The delivery rides the line between power and clarity, never getting lost in the instrumentation. And that matters, because this is a track that wants you to hear the message as much as feel it. The production leans into that balance too—clean enough to highlight detail, but still carrying the grit that keeps it rooted in metal.
Knowing this is part of a larger conceptual series adds another layer. “Observer” doesn’t feel like a standalone peak—it feels like a turning point. There’s narrative momentum baked into it, like something is shifting, evolving, breaking through. That kind of long-form vision is rare in independent releases, and it gives the track a sense of purpose beyond just replay value. If there’s any critique, it’s that the ambition might go over some listeners’ heads on first listen. This isn’t immediate, surface-level metal—it asks for attention. But for those willing to lean in, there’s depth here that rewards repeat plays.
